Al-Fursan tied in round 17 against Al Sailiya
Forsan Al-Khor imposed a positive tie on his opponent Al Sailiya with a goal for each, in the match that took place between them in the seventeenth week of the QNB Stars League on Tuesday evening, February 23, 2021. Iranian Ramin Rezaian scored the goal of Al-Sailiya in the "4" minute, while the Brazilian Al-Khor Raphael equalized in the "77" minute. Al-Sailiya raised his score to 23 points, while Al-Khor became 14 points. Al Sailiya snatched an early goal in the fourth minute of the first half by Iranian Ramin Rezaian from a ball that Muhammad Muddather crossed with a penalty and Ramin struck directly to cross from under the hands of goalkeeper Baba Jibril. The goal surprised Al-Khor and his coach Shafer, as well as stimulating Al-Sailiya and his coach, Sami Al-Trabelsi, to search for another goal, which made the play an argument between the two teams, and the desire escalated between strengthening Al-Sailiya and compensating Al-Khor, through the exchange of offensive adapters. Al-Sailiya threw after the goal with all its weight in order to add another goal, but Al-Khor began to respond through the attack and climb across the sides, especially in the last minutes of the first half, which witnessed a clear rush to Al Khor seeking to return. Al Khor lost the efforts of his player Lasuja, who was injured early in the game, and Ahmed Hassan Al Mohannadi participated in his place. During the second half, Al-Khor's performance improved and he tried to return by rushing to the attack and took the road towards the goal and was met by a clear retreat from Al-Sailiya, who wanted to maintain his goal that he scored in the first half, and relied on the rebound balls, perhaps hijacking Al-Khour with another goal, but that was not achieved. There were some opportunities for Al Khor, some of which were faced by goalkeeper Claude Amin, and others missed the final touch. Al-Khor player Vettva was able to move forward, and Al-Khor managed to equalize in the 77th minute of the match through a fixed ball obtained near the penalty arc, and the Brazilian professional Raphael succeeded with a wonderful shot to the right of goalkeeper Claude Amin to embrace the net strongly. After the goal, Al Khor went up from the search for the winning goal, but the balls that were available for its players were not translated into goals, so the match ended in a positive tie with a goal for each team.
